About

The robotic thyroidectomy (RT) has excellent cosmetic and several functional results. But there were no definite evidence of oncological safety of robotic thyroidectomy yet. To assure the surgical completeness of robotic thyroidectomy, the investigators compared robotic thyroidectomy and conventional open thyroidectomy (OT) by means of the postoperative radioactive iodine (RAI) uptake of possible remnant thyroid tissue and stimulated TG level.

Inclusion criteria

  • age ≥ 20years
  • papillary thyroid carcinoma patients who underwent conventional open or robotic bilateral total thyroidectomy at YUHS(Yonsei University Health System)
  • patient who underwent postoperative low doe (30mCI) RAI ablation therapy at YUHS

Exclusion criteria

  • pregnant, lactating women
  • patient who underwent postoperative low dose RAI at another hospital
  • patient with distant metastasis
  • patient who underwent combined operation with bilateral total thyroidectomy (ex) Modified radical neck dissection, selective neck node excision d/t lateral neck node metastasis
  • patient who underwent High dose (more than 30 mCI) RAI therapy

Trial design

150 participants in 2 patient groups

Group 1
Description:
Group 1 : conventional open thyroidectomy group (papillary thyroid carcinoma patient who underwent conventional open bilateral total thyroidectomy procedure and postoperative low dose RAI therapy)
Group 2
Description:
Group 2 : robotic thyroidectomy group (papillary thyroid carcinoma patient who underwent robotic bilateral total thyroidectomy procedure and postoperative low dose RAI therapy)
